Born in Buffalo, NY, singer/songwriter David Stith spent his formative years surrounded by music. The son of a college wind ensemble/church director and pianist mother with a pair of opera singing sisters, Stith began his own music career after a long affair with writing, illustration, and graphic design. After meeting and working with Shara Worden of eclectic dream pop outfit My Brightest Diamond upon relocating to New York City, he began writing and recording his own songs, resulting in his independently released debut, Ichabod and Apple. Heavy Ghost, the debut album from DM Stith, had an almost supernatural effect when it was released in March of 2009. Reviewers and fans alike acclaimed it as a stunning debut unlike anything else they'd heard in a while. Stith's peers received it just as well: Ed Droste of Grizzly Bear twittered about it calling it a ?lovely album,? and Bat for Lashes picked it for her New York Times playlist, saying ?It traverses all these magical landscapes? almost like Alice through the looking glass. Most everything about DM Stith's remarkable debut suggests that it's something of an anomaly. Heavy Ghost adheres to few preconceived notions belonging to any one movement or style, but sounds like it could have been influenced by any number of factors just barely out of the range of recognition.
